Vocabulary Word
Definition
obtuse angle   an angle whose measure is greater than 90 degrees and less than 180 degrees  
🗑
acute angle   an angle that has a measure less than 90 degrees  
🗑
straight angle   an angle that measures 180 degrees  
🗑
chord   a line segment with endpoints on a circle  
🗑
degree   a unit for measuring angles or for measuring temperature  
🗑
diagonal   slanting from one corner of a four sided figure, as a square, to another corner  
🗑
scalene triangle   a triangle with no congruent sides  
🗑
isosceles triangle   a triangle with exactly two congruent sides  
🗑
equilateral triangle   a triangle with three congruent sides  
🗑
congruent   having the same size and shape  
🗑
similar   having the same shape, but not necessarily the same size  
🗑
parallel   lines in a plane that do not intersect  
🗑
perpendicular   two lines that intersect to form right angles  
🗑
circumference   the distance around a circle  
🗑
diameter   a line segment that passes through the center of a circle and has its endpoints on the circle  
🗑
radius   a line segment with one endpoint at the center of a circle and the other endpoint on the circle
